Synopsis

This study of the English sieges from the Norman Conquest to the end of the War of the Roses examines the evolution of siege warfare & the events that culminated with each siege. The skills of the engineer, the architect, and the miner are as important to Warner's theme as the courage of the troops & the strategies of their commanders. Investigates Wallingford, Ch teau Gaillard, Bedford, and Rouen--sieges that decided far more in history than the campaigns they climaxed.
